Q: How do we unlock the load-test vault for the Tillhouse checkout flow? A: The Gantry load harness keeps its synthetic-payment keys in a sealed store. If a run aborts mid-scenario, the store locks and subsequent runs fail fast. Before rerunning, unseal it using the recovery passphrase below.

strongbox words: wenix-ralax

## Compaction check

When the Brindlequeue brokers start grumbling about disk, it's usually compaction lagging on the high-volume topics. Peek at the compactor dashboard first — if the cleaner thread is stuck, bounce it via the admin API rather than restarting the broker. The admin API lives on the Ferrowmint internal service and expects the key below.

API key for tagef-fafop: vxb2-ta

- [ ] Confirm the Cartwright pick-list optimizer honors aisle-adjacency weights after the Fenley depot remap. Run the replay suite against last Tuesday's order batch, verify pick-path length regressed by no more than 1%, and capture the solver seed. Record results against the optimizer build identified by the token below.

trace token, tawep-fahif: htk3_b58

**Ticket #2093 — Schema registry vault sealed**

The vault holding signing credentials for Eventry, our event schema registry, sealed itself after the host rebooted during patching. Until it's unsealed, new schema versions can't be published, though reads are unaffected. Future maintainers: this happens after any unplanned reboot; it's expected behavior, not corruption. Unseal from the registry host using the admin CLI. When prompted, enter the recovery passphrase recorded directly below.

strongbox words: norwyn-wenael-aldvan-aldiel-wendor-holael

## Calendar Sync Conflicts (Meetwell)

Welcome aboard! Every so often Meetwell's sync worker and the Grovia calendar bridge both try to update the same event, and you get a duplicate-invite storm. Don't panic — it's almost always a stale lease on the sync cursor. First, pause the bridge worker, then clear the cursor lease from the admin panel. Wait two minutes before resuming so the lease TTL expires cleanly. If duplicates keep appearing, check the reconciliation flags. The values the worker reads at startup are as follows.

config for bawig-fadup:
[zorix]
host = zorix.lumicworks.corp
user = zorix_svc
database = zorix_prod